About Health in Grainger County, Tennessee
Grainger faces a significant health crisis
Grainger County's life expectancy of 71.3 years trails the U.S. average of 76 years by 4.7 years, reflecting serious population health challenges. The county's poor or fair health rate of 26.2% is one of the highest in its region, indicating widespread health struggles.
Bottom tier in Tennessee rankings
At 71.3 years, Grainger County's life expectancy falls 1.1 years below Tennessee's average of 72.4 years, placing it among the state's most challenged counties. The uninsured rate of 11.6% mirrors the state average, though provider scarcity may limit care access despite coverage.
Critically short on primary care providers
Grainger County has the lowest provider density in its region, with only 13 primary care providers per 100,000 residents—compared to 36 in Giles County and 56 in Franklin County. This severe shortfall compounds the county's already-elevated poor health rate of 26.2%.
Provider shortage creates urgent access barriers
Grainger County residents face a critical healthcare access crisis: just 13 primary care providers and 20 mental health providers per 100,000 residents make routine care difficult to access. Even with 11.6% uninsured, the remaining 88.4% with insurance struggle to find available providers.

Data Sources
Health data sourced from the County Health Rankings & Roadmaps, a collaboration between the Robert Wood Johnson Foundation and the University of Wisconsin Population Health Institute.
